Job Summary :
Ensure efficient hatchery operations by monitoring incubating and hatching operations, troubleshooting, and responding to immediate equipment issues. Follow strict biosecurity protocols. This is a shower-in facility.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ities : Include the following : other duties may be assigned Monitor and correct incubator and hatcher performance.
Analyze and debug (troubleshoot) machine errors (alarms).
Support equipment "preventative maintenance program"
Perform calibration testing / adjustment on equipment.
Document root cause / corrective actions and maintain equipment maintenance log.
Maintain inventory control and submit PRs as needed for continued machine performance
Assist hatchery maintenance program.
Fill-in as needed to support hatchery labor.
Ensure Bio-Security measures are maintained.
Perform housekeeping duties as directed by hatchery supervision.
Take a proactive role in assuring safe, quality products are produced by immediately addressing any safety or quality concerns.
